BIERLING: Gladys (Schenk) of Hensall

At Queensway Nursing Home, Hensall on Friday, February 17, 2017, formerly of Exeter, in her 92nd year. Beloved wife of the late Andrew (Andy) Bierling and friend of the late Jim Harrigan. Dear mother of John Bierling of Exeter, Bob and Sue Bierling of Port Stanley, and Kate Bierling of Exeter. Dear grandmother of Wendy, Derek, Jerry; Krista, Joe; Amy, Allison; great-grandmother of Ashley, Rachael, Tristan, Matthew, Alex, Liam, Abbey, Carter, Cameron, Logan, and Pressley; and one great-great-grandson Jaxon. Dear sister and sister-in-law of Peter and Geraldine Schenk of Teeswater. Predeceased by a son Dennis, daughters-in-law Charmaine and Debbie, a brother Gerald and his wife Rita, and a sister Helen.

Friends may call at the Haskett Funeral Home, 370 William Street, (one west of Main) Exeter Wednesday evening 6 – 8 PM where a Memorial Service will be held on Thursday, February 23rd at 11AM with Rev. Jim Innes officiating. Cremation with interment Exeter Cemetery.  A Legion Ladies Auxiliary Service will be held in the funeral home Wednesday evening at 7PM.  

Donations to the Royal Canadian Legion R.E. Pooley Branch No. 167 would be appreciated by the family.
